How Our Roof Leak Water Removal Service Actually Works
When you call us for roof leak water removal, our team springs into action. We understand that every minute counts, and our goal is to start the extraction process within 60 minutes of your call. Our process involves:
Initial Assessment and Inspection
We’ll assess the damage and identify the source of the leak to find out the best course of action.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ure we’re addressing the root cause of the issue.
Water Extraction and Removal
We’ll extract the water using industrial-grade equ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and wet/dry vacuums.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and ensuring your home is safe and dry.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ll sanitize and disinfect the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This step is critical in ensuring your home is safe and healthy for you and your family.
Final Inspection and Report
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your home is safe and dry. We’ll provide a detailed report of the damage and our recommendations for repairs, giving you peace of mind and a clear plan for moving forward.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Bristol, NY
The cost of roof leak water removal in Bristol, NY var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$500 | The severity of the damage and the complexity of the job |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ment required |
| Structural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ment required |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required |
| Final Inspection and Report |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the job and the time required for the inspection |
